Job Title: Ocean Export Supervisor
Job Location: Chicago, Illinois
We have an exciting opportunity for an
Ocean Export Supervisor who will be responsible for the end to end performance and profitability of the local Ocean Export product team which includes Operations and Customer Service. This role drives performance of the ocean freight specialists team while ensuring quality and regulatory compliance.
Key Responsibilities: - Manages, oversees, and performs supervisory tasks to direct and control activities performed to effectively manage the end to end Ocean Export processes
- Serves as the escalation contact for customer's Ocean Export shipments; responsible for the financial aspects and results; sets, communicates, and drives KPIs to ensure customer satisfaction
- Assumes responsibility for good working practices, safety, and security for customer shipments and staff
- Collaborate with internal customers (Ocean Gateway, Trucking, and, Handling etc.) for seamless customer service and improve process flows; engage with sales to grow business by participating in sales meetings and customer calls
- Review and manage month end reports, review P/L, open Accounts Payables Accounts Receivables; escalates carrier performance issues when required with the US Ocean Freight Product team
Skills / Requirements :- 4+ years of experience with Freight Forwarding experience required, strong preference for Ocean Export experience
- 1+ years of supervisory / leadership experience strongly preferred
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ience/qualification
- Basic knowledge of Cargo Wise system is preferred
- Demonstrated leadership ability to include driving KPIs, employee engagement / team building. Strong ability to develop, coach, train, and mentor staff to success
- Exceptional communication skills (verbal, written, and presentations)
- Strong computer skills: Microsoft (i.e. Excel, Word, PowerPoint, & Outlook)
